The priests in the local family of parishes are committed to supporting and helping one another

Summer time presents a particular challenge because the timetable of Masses we have at weekends is only sustainable if all six priests are all available.  As well as time for holidays, along with weekend Masses, priests will also attend to other ministries including funerals, weddings, baptisms, care homes and daily Masses.  The Masses celebrated each week by the local priests at Care Choice, Clonakilty Community Hospital and the Convent of Mercy continue during the summer months.

The priests have worked together to create a fair and sustainable timetable for the months of June, July and August.

Summer Masses 2024Summer Masses 2024

 

From Saturday 1 June to Sunday 1 September 2024 inclusive, the weekend Mass times will be as follows:

Saturday Vigil Mass

  • 6:30pm - Lisavaird
  • 7:00pm - Clonakilty
  • 7:30pm - Clogagh or Courtmacsherry (alternate weeks)

Sunday Mass

  • 8:30am - Clonakilty
  • 10:00am - Ardfield or Rathbarry (alternate weeks)
  • 10:00am - Barryroe or 11:30am Timoleague (alternate weeks)
  • 10:00am - Darrara (alternate weeks)
  • 11:00am - Rossmore or Bealad (alternate weeks)
  • 11:30am - Clonakilty
  • 11:30am - Rosscarbery

Fr. Ted Collins, Fr. Tom Hayes, Fr. John Kingston, Fr John McCarthy, Fr. Dave O’Connell, Fr. Fergus Tuohy
